A pair of married ex-convicts trying to go straight get jobs at a department store. A gangster who knows about their past threatens to expose it unless they agree to help him rob the department store.

Ann Rutherford was simultaneously starring as Polly Benedict in the Andy Hardy series—imagine audiences seeing her as both wholesome teen and ex-con wife in the same year.
This 1946 release captures immediate postwar anxiety about employment for returning veterans with records, a real social crisis Hollywood rarely addressed directly.
